LIMESTONE COUNTY, AL (WAFF) -

According to the National Chicken Council, Americans will eat 1.25 billion chicken wings during Super Bowl Sunday. That is three times the normal amount eaten and provides a boost for Alabama's robust poultry industry.

Limestone County poultry farmer David Ruf said he sells about a million chickens a year, and that he is glad wings are so popular.

"Anytime consumers can up what they're eating three times, it's got to be good for business," he said.

Alabama's poultry industry makes $9.4 billion a year, making the state the third-largest poultry producing state.

Ruf said he will be like many of the estimated 150 million Americans watching the New York Giants battle the New England Patriots for the Lombardi Trophy.

"Wings are a good safe product. Nutritious to eat. You can bet I'm going to eat my share," he said.
